Abstract

The invention provides a continuous casting spraying and cooling device for cooling a casting blank. The continuous casting spraying and cooling device comprises a cylindrical roller and nozzle sets.The cylindrical roller is used for conveying the casting blank, the nozzle sets are used for cooling the roller and the casting blank, and the nozzle sets are arranged on the side, away from the casting blank, of the roller. A single nozzle set is internally provided with a plurality of nozzles, and the nozzles are all arranged at a certain angle to the axis of the roller. By rotating the nozzlesin the nozzle sets at a certain angle, the attenuation of water droplet pressure and the change of water droplet diameter are eliminated, so that the heat transfer of the casting blank in all transverse positions is more uniform, the transverse temperature gradient of the casting blank is smaller, and the phenomenon that in an original production process, some high alloy steel grades are prone tooccurring transverse cracks and star cracks is improved, so that the quality of the casting blank is improved.

technical field [0001] The invention belongs to the technical field of metallurgy, in particular to a continuous casting spray cooling device. Background technique [0002] Continuous casting is a casting process in which molten steel continuously passes through a water-cooled crystallizer, condenses into a hard shell, and is continuously pulled out from the outlet below the crystallizer. In the continuous casting process, in order to obtain high-quality slab, it is required that the temperature of the slab should decrease evenly along the casting direction, and the transverse temperature gradient perpendicular to the casting direction should be as small as possible to reduce the impact of thermal stress and mechanical stress on the slab. quality impact. Therefore, spray water cooling becomes a key factor affecting the quality of the slab.
